Median Home Price in Woodhaven, MI

The median home value in Woodhaven, MI is $273,960 as of 2026-06-30, up 4.26% from a year earlier.

Woodhaven ranks #69 of 149 Michigan cities tracked here by median home value, and sits 4.4% above the state's city median of $262,333. It sits in Wayne County, where the county-wide median is $181,365.

Crime in Woodhaven

Woodhaven police recorded a violent crime rate of 112 per 100,000 residents in 2024 — around the middle of the range for reporting cities. Property crime runs at 1,542 per 100,000.

Reported by the city's own police department to the FBI's Uniform Crime Reporting Program (what this covers).
